Brown the ground beef and Italian sausage until no pink remains and the meat is fully crumbled. Use a meat thermometer to check that the internal temperature reaches 160°F for food safety.
Yes, you can substitute dried basil. Use about 1/3 of the amount of fresh basil (so if the recipe calls for 1/4 cup fresh, use 1-2 tablespoons dried). Dried herbs are more concentrated in flavor.
Cheese ravioli is recommended, but you can also use meat-filled ravioli for extra flavor. Choose fresh or frozen ravioli that are medium-sized for best results.

Brilliant Million Dollar Ravioli Casserole Recipe
- Total Time: 90 minutes
- Yield: 8 1x
Description
Comfort meets luxury in this million dollar ravioli casserole, blending rich cheeses and savory meats into a hearty Italian-inspired feast. Creamy layers and golden-brown edges promise a delicious dinner that brings warmth and satisfaction to your table.
Ingredients
Pasta:
- 1 box lasagna noodles
- 1 box cheese ravioli
Meat and Cheese:
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 lb ground italian sausage
- 2 cups ricotta cheese
- 2 cups mozzarella cheese
- 1/2 cup parmesan cheese
Sauce and Seasonings:
- 2 jars marinara sauce
- 1 can crushed tomatoes
- 2 cloves garlic
- 1 tbsp italian seasoning
- 1 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 2 large eggs
- 1/4 cup fresh basil leaves
- 2 tbsp olive oil
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375°F and lightly grease a large casserole dish to prevent sticking.
- In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ium-high heat and brown the ground beef and Italian sausage together, breaking the meat into small crumbles until fully cooked and no pink remains.
- Drain excess fat from the meat mixture and return to the skillet, adding minced garlic, Italian seasoning, salt, and black pepper, stirring to combine and infuse flavors.
- In a separate mixing bowl, whisk together ricotta cheese, eggs, and chopped fresh basil, creating a creamy and herbal cheese mixture.
- Layer the bottom of the casserole dish with lasagna noodles, slightly overlapping to create a complete base covering.
- Spread half of the meat mixture evenly over the lasagna noodles, followed by a layer of cheese ravioli.
- Pour half of the marinara sauce and crushed tomatoes over the ravioli layer, ensuring even coverage.
- Spread the ricotta cheese mixture on top, creating a smooth and even layer.
- Sprinkle mozzarella and parmesan cheeses generously over the ricotta layer.
- Repeat the layering process with remaining lasagna noodles, meat, ravioli, sauce, and cheese layers.
- Cover the casserole dish with aluminum foil and bake for 45 minutes.
- Remove foil and continue baking for an additional 15 minutes until the top is golden and bubbly.
- Allow the casserole to rest for 10 minutes before serving to help it set and make cutting easier.
- Garnish with additional fresh basil leaves if desired and serve hot.
Notes
- Customize meat choices by swapping ground beef and sausage with turkey, chicken, or plant-based alternatives for dietary preferences.
- Create a gluten-free version by using gluten-free lasagna noodles and checking ravioli labels for wheat-free options.
- Enhance flavor depth by adding roasted garlic or sautéed onions to the meat mixture for extra complexity.
- Prep ahead by assembling the casserole a day before baking, storing covered in the refrigerator to develop richer flavors.
